

2013 Senate Bill 123: Expand local convention facility authorities (Senate Roll Call)
Passed 37 to 0 in the Senate on March 6, 2013, to allow the Grand Rapids and Kent County convention facility authorities to borrow and spend more to build or buy a second facility, including a "market" or a sports facility (which could mean an arena or stadium). The bill would also eliminate the 12 year term limits on members of these entities' boards.
